I see evolution every day in the lab. Bacteria divide up to every 20 minutes. That's an incredible amount of generations. They adapt to lab conditions, they change expression levels, they change behavior, they change protein composition. This can even be used to carry out "targeted evolution". Evolution is a tool in bacteriology used on a daily basis, and a problem that needs to be taken care of.
